Starliege Photon Blast Dragon

Starliege Photon Blast Dragon is a Starlight Rare XYZ Monster from 2025 Mega-Pack (EN034) in the Yu-Gi-Oh! TCG. Stats: LIGHT, Level 4, ATK 1800, DEF 2500. Archetype: Galaxy-Eyes. Cactaur's latest catalog snapshot shows a market reference near $0.37 for ungraded copies.
